Igneous Rocks

Igneous rocks are rocks that are formed either under ground or above ground

Under ground igneous rocks are forms when magma deep within the earth cool and form intrusive igneous rocks

Extrusive igneous rocks are formed when magma comes to the surface and becomes lave then cools and hardens to form extrusive igneous rocks

IGNEOUS ROCK-Rock formed by solidification of molten magma.

Metamorphic Rocks

Metamorphic rocks are types of rocks that change into a different rock.

These rocks are subjected to heat and pressure.

From the heat and pressure the rocks completely change underground.

Sedimentary Rocks

Sedimentary rocks are rocks that are made up of pieces of earth that have eroded and deposited over thousands of years

The sediment form layers and then the bottom layers get pressed together and form sedimentary rocks

Rock CycleThe rock cycle is the formation, breakdown, and

reformation of rocks as a result of sedimentary, igneous, and metamorphic processes.

For rocks to change they go through weather and erosion, heat and pressure, deposition, and cooling and crystallization

WEATHERING-The basic chemical process that causes exposed rock to decompose.

EROSION-The process by which the surface of the earth is worn away by the action of water, wind, ect.

DEPOSITION-The state of being deposited by water, air, or ice.

Fossils

Fossils are preserved remains or traces of plants, animals, and organisms from the remote past that have turned into stone

Fossils form in sedimentary rock because the plants, animals, and organisms get traped between the layers of sediment that form over thousands of years
